Zuckerberg among top donors in Ebola fight

10/28/2014 // West Palm Beach, Florida, US // JusticeNewsFlash // Justice News Flash // (press release)

U.S. – Billionaire Internet entrepreneur Mark Zuckerberg has pledged $25 million to help in the Ebola response. As reported by Business Insider, the donation has been among the largest contributions pledged by individuals, countries, and foundations.

Zuckerberg’s donation nearly meets or amounts to more than that pledged by some countries, including India, which has pledged a reported $12,000,000. The United States has pledged $750,000,000.

President Barack Obama is quoted in the report as stating of the country’s significant donation, “This is not simply charity… Probably the single most important thing that we can do to prevent a more serious Ebola outbreak in this country is making sure that we get what is a raging epidemic right now in West Africa under control.”
